SpaceX (SPCX)

SpaceX recently held its IPO, marking a historic event in the public markets with massive volume (estimated at $35 billion on day one). • The stock opened at $150, saw a high of $176, and settled around the $162–$164 range. • Key Investment Thesis: * Cost Leadership: SpaceX has reduced the cost of reaching orbit by 20x compared to NASA’s space shuttle (from $54,000/kg to $2,720/kg). * Starlink: Generates significant recurring revenue ($11.4 billion projected for 2025) by providing global broadband. * Future Frontiers: Potential for "Orbital Compute" (space-based data centers to solve Earth's power constraints) and asteroid mining for rare earth minerals. * Market Dominance: In 2025, SpaceX is projected to launch 85% of all satellites globally.

Space Sector & Competitors (ASTS, RKLB, SPCE)

• Other space-related stocks like AST Spacemobile (ASTS), Rocket Lab (RKLB), and Virgin Galactic (SPCE) experienced a "pump and dump" dynamic around the SpaceX IPO. • Many of these stocks rallied 10-30% the day before the IPO and were "destroyed" (down 11-20%) on the actual IPO day. • Rocket Lab (RKLB) specifically saw a "brutal" trade where it was added to the NASDAQ 100, causing a short-term spike that stopped out short-sellers before the stock plummeted.
